The 1st Cohort Starts January 2025

The HerGreen Startup Incubator is a dynamic program designed to support and empower women entrepreneurs in the green tech industry. Launching its first cohort in January 2025, this initiative is proudly funded by the GWC Foundation in partnership with Atlanta Tech Park. We are committed to fostering innovation and sustainability by providing an inclusive platform for women to thrive in the tech ecosystem.

Program Highlights:

  • Duration: A comprehensive 16-week incubator program, followed by a 1-year residency at Atlanta Tech Park.
  • Cohort Size: The first cohort will enroll 35 women, offering a personalized and interactive experience.
  • Location: Participants will engage in the program locally, in person, at Atlanta Tech Park, a hub for tech innovation.
  • Selection Process: A pre-interview process ensures that we select women who are passionate and committed to making a difference in the green tech sector.

  1. What is a business incubator? A business incubator is a program or organization that provides support to startup companies and entrepreneurs, typically offering resources like office space, mentorship, networking opportunities, and sometimes funding to help them grow and succeed.
  2. Who can join a business incubator? Business incubators usually cater to early-stage startups and entrepreneurs with innovative ideas or products. Eligibility criteria can vary, so it’s important to check the specific requirements of the incubator you’re interested in.
  3. What kind of support can I expect from a business incubator? Incubators offer a range of support services, including mentorship from industry experts, networking opportunities, access to investors, office space, and resources like legal, accounting, and technical assistance.
  4. How long does the incubation process last? The duration of incubation can vary depending on the program, but it typically ranges from a few months to a couple of years.
  5. Is there a cost to apply to a business incubator? Some incubators charge a fee or require equity in your company in exchange for their services, while others are funded by grants or partnerships and may be free for participants. It’s important to understand the terms before joining. (There is no fee to apply to the HerGreen Startup Incubator)
  6. How can I apply to a business incubator? Application processes vary, but they often involve submitting a detailed business plan, participating in interviews, and sometimes pitching your idea to a selection committee. (Fill in the form below and someone will be in contact with you)
  7. What are the benefits of joining a business incubator? Joining an incubator can provide valuable resources, mentorship, and networking opportunities to help your startup grow. It can also offer credibility and visibility in the industry.
  8. Can I join an incubator if I’m working on my business part-time? Many incubators require full-time commitment, but some may accommodate part-time entrepreneurs. It’s best to check the specific requirements of the incubator. (HerGreen Startup Is A Full-Time Incubator For 16 Weeks)
  9. What happens after the incubation period ends? After the incubation period, startups are typically expected to graduate and operate independently. Some incubators offer ongoing support or alumni networks to help graduates continue their growth.
  10. How do I choose the right incubator for my business? Consider factors like the incubator’s focus areas, the resources and support offered, the success rate of its graduates, and the compatibility with your business goals and needs
